Transaction 870fd381e51fb4ee4319baf3c936d5340584ada80e580ed23d42f10a9b28ecd3

block
00eb037206eff695bd81b21120083ce3ac31c3be64b20dd4b481658df570e998

7 Inputs

2 Outputs